🧴 Shiseido Senka Perfect Whip Foam Cleanser 120g — $4.99 (was $8.99)
📍 BTrust (Richmond Hill)
This cleanser is genuinely popular for good reason — dense, fine foam, effective at removing sunscreen and light makeup, and gentle enough for daily use. At $4.99 versus the usual $8.99, buying two or three tubes makes sense. Unopened shelf life is three years.

🍚 Floating Market Thai Jasmine Rice 40lb — $29.99/bag (was $39.99/bag)
📍 Yours
The standout deal of the week. A ten-dollar saving on a 40-pound bag of fragrant Thai jasmine rice is hard to pass up. At this price, a family of three has rice covered for two to three months. Transfer to a sealed container or large airtight bin when you get home to keep it fresh and bug-free.
